Barbiturate
A class of sedative and sleep-inducing drugs derived from barbituric acid, historically used for anxiety, insomnia, and seizure disorders.
Barbiturates
Depressant drugs, such as Nembutal and Seconal, that decrease central nervous system activity.
Depressant Drugs
A class of substances that reduce the activity of the central nervous system, leading to sedation, relaxation, and decreased inhibition.
Central-Nervous-System Activity
Refers to the functions and processes carried out by the brain and spinal cord.
